India on Tuesday named D. Bala Venkatesh Varma, an Indian Foreign Service officer of the 1988 batch, as its new Ambassador to Russia.

Currently serving as India's Ambassador to Spain, Varma is expected to take up the new assignment shortly, according to a statement issued by the External Affairs Ministry.

He will succeed Pankaj Saran in Moscow.
